Before making a purchase, it's crucial to consider several factors. Heres a breakdown of the most important features:
The official size of futsal goals is 3 meters wide by 2 meters high (approximately 9 feet 10 inches x 6 feet 7 inches). While regulation sizes are ideal for competitive play, smaller portable models can be suitable for recreational use or younger players. It's essential to check the dimensions before buying to ensure they meet your needs and court specifications.

The quality of the net directly impacts its lifespan and ability to withstand intense gameplay. Look for nets made from durable, UV-resistant materials with reinforced stitching. The attachment system should be easy to use and secure quick release clips are a convenient option for portable goals.
Stability is paramount when choosing futsal goals. Portable models may require counterweights (sandbags or water bags) for added stability, especially during games with aggressive play. Regulation and fixed goals should have a stable base that prevents shifting or tipping. Consider the weight capacity of the goal to ensure it can handle multiple players colliding against it without collapsing. This is particularly important in competitive matches.
If you plan on moving your futsal goal frequently, portability and storage are essential considerations. Portable models with foldable/collapsible frames offer significant advantages in terms of ease of movement and space-saving storage. Fixed goals, obviously, cannot be moved once installed.
